Jorge Donn was a very famous ballet dancer from Argentina. He was born on February 25, 1947, in Ciudad Jardin, which is in Buenos Aires. He became known all over the world for his amazing dancing.

Jorge Donn was especially famous for working with a dance company called the Ballet of the 20th Century, led by the well-known choreographer Maurice Béjart. He passed away on November 30, 1992, in Lausanne, Switzerland, after an illness.

A Star is Born

Jorge Donn started dancing when he was very young. He loved to move and express himself through ballet. His talent was clear from the beginning. When he was just 15 years old, he moved to Europe to follow his dream of becoming a professional dancer.

Working with Maurice Béjart

In 1963, Jorge Donn joined Maurice Béjart's company, the Ballet of the 20th Century. This was a very important moment in his career. Béjart was a famous choreographer who created new and exciting ballets. Jorge Donn quickly became one of Béjart's favorite dancers. He performed in many of Béjart's most famous works, showing off his strong and expressive dancing style.

One of his most memorable performances was in Béjart's Boléro by Ravel. Jorge Donn was the first male dancer to perform this challenging and powerful piece, which was usually danced by a woman. This showed how unique and talented he was.

Dancing on Screen

Besides dancing on stage, Jorge Donn also appeared in movies. This allowed even more people to see his incredible talent.

Film Appearances

  • 1975: Je suis né à Venise by Maurice Béjart — He played two roles: Jorge and The Sun.
  • 1978: Flesh Color by François Weyergans — He played a character named Ramón.
  • 1981: Les Uns et les Autres by Claude Lelouch — He played Boris Itovitch and Sergei Itovitch. This movie helped him become even more famous around the world.
  • 1990: There Were Days... and Moons by Claude Lelouch — He appeared as a dancer in this film.

Legacy

Jorge Donn is remembered as one of the most important ballet dancers of his time. He inspired many dancers and audiences with his powerful performances and unique style. His work with Maurice Béjart changed how people saw ballet, making it more modern and exciting. Even after his passing, his performances continue to be celebrated and remembered by dance lovers everywhere.
